Sex education is a broad term that encompasses education on sexual anatomy, sexual health, contraception, and relationships. It's an essential part of human development, aiming to guide individuals, especially young people, in understanding their bodies, making informed decisions about their sexual health, and fostering healthy relationships.

Parents and guardians often play a crucial role in providing sex education. Their involvement can significantly influence a child's or adolescent's understanding and attitudes towards sexuality. The approach to sex education can vary widely among families, influenced by cultural, religious, and personal beliefs.
